    Default Moving zencart to root directory

    I want to make it so that the zencart index page is my site's index page. Currently, i have an intro page which has a link that links to zencart. Everything is in 'zencart' ofcourse. How do i go about making zencart the site's index page?

    Default Re: Moving zencart to root directory

    Move all your Zencart folders and files to the root directory (sounds like it's public_html on your server) - a 5 second job using your FTP program.

    Edit includes/configure.php and admin/includes/configure.php (or the name of your admin directory) to remove the /zencart from the paths.

    Then do step #2 in the tutorial, removing the /zencart part of the path.
